Review - Shrek: Come Look At The Freaks
by Kristin Salaky - Jan 4, 2009


Wipe off the green makeup, bulldoze the castle and get rid of the tap-dancing rats- no, keep the tap-dancing rats - and Shrek, despite its fairy-tale setting and gentle lesson about embracing the qualities that make us different, reveals itself as just a good ol' musical comedy. And a darn enjoyable one at that. Of course, whether you find it sophomoric or smartass might depend on your reaction to fart jokes, anachronistic contemporary references and visual quotes from classic musicals, but director Jason Moore has his terrific cast performing their goofy antics with slick professionalism. Add some very humorous puppetry and bright, catchy tunes and you've got a fun night out.

Brian d' Arcy James Will Guest On NBC's WEEKEND TODAY 1/24
by BWW News Desk - Jan 24, 2009


SHREK THE MUSICAL star Brian d'Arcy James, who plays Shrek in the new Broadway show, will be featured on NBC's 'Weekend Today' performing 'Who I'd Be' live in-studio on Saturday, January 24. 'Weekend Today' airs nationally on NBC (channel 4, WNBC in the tri-state area). Check local listings. That same morning, James will also be interviewed on WNBC's 'Saturday Today in New York,' airing in the tri-state area after 'Weekend Today' between 9:00am & 10:00am. SHREK THE MUSICAL opened at The Broadway Theatre on Sunday, December 14, 2008. SHREK THE MUSICAL stars Tony Award? nominee Brian d'Arcy James as Shrek, Tony Award? winner Sutton Foster as Princess Fiona, Tony Award? nominee Christopher Sieber as Lord Farquaad, Tony Award? nominee Daniel Breaker as Donkey and Tony Award? nominee John Tartaglia as Pinocchio. Joining these actors are Cameron Adams, Haven Burton, Jennifer Cody, Ben Crawford, Bobby Daye, Ryan Duncan, Sarah Jane Everman, Aymee Garcia, Leah Greenhaus, Justin Greer, Lisa Ho, Chris Hoch, Danette Holden, Marty Lawson, Jacob Ming-Trent, Carolyn Ockert-Haythe, Marissa O'Donnell, Denny Paschall, Rachel Resheff, Greg Reuter, Adam Riegler, Noah Rivera, Heather Jane Rolff, Jennifer Simard, Rachel Stern, Dennis Stowe, David F.M. Vaughn. SHREK THE MUSICAL is an entirely new musical based on the story and characters from William Steig's book Shrek!, as well as the DreamWorks Animation film Shrek, the first chapter of the Shrek movie series.

Photo Coverage: SHREK The Musical Hits the Studio!
by Eddie Varley - Jan 13, 2009


On Monday, January 12th, the entire cast of Shrek The Musical congregated at Legacy Studios in New York City to record the cast album of the stage production. Shrek The Musical features music written by Olivier Award-winner Jeanine Tesori (Thoroughly Modern Millie & Caroline, or Change), a book and lyrics by Pulitzer Prize winner David Lindsay-Abaire (Rabbit Hole), and the production is directed by Tony nominee Jason Moore (Avenue Q). Jeanine Tesori also will be at the helm of the cast album as producer along with Shrek The Musical's sound designer Peter Hylenski as the album's co-producer. 'SHREK THE MUSICAL' Has Best Week Ever, Sets House Record
by Gabrielle Sierra - Dec 29, 2008


SHREK THE MUSICAL had their best week ever, grossing $1,260,282 for the 8-performance week ending December 28 and set a single performance house record grossing $202,020 for the Saturday, December 27 matinee. SHREK THE MUSICAL opened at The Broadway Theatre on Sunday, December 14, 2008.

Photo Coverage: SHREK Gypsy Robe Ceremony
by Walter McBride - Dec 17, 2008


Eric Sciotto was the Gypsy Robe recipient for Pal Joey at Studio 54. He passed on the robe to Shrek's talented dynamo Jennifer Cody in a fun and emotion filled ceremony. The colorful Gypsy Robe, embellished with mementos from Broadway musicals, is presented to the cast member who has the most Broadway chorus credits.
